PROMOTED A LOTTERY.
(press association tblegkam.) AUCKLAND, July 9. Yesterday three officials of the Takapuna Boating Club were prosecuted under the Gaming Act in connexion with a lottery at the Winter Show. This morning the police said that it had been represented that the club was an incorporated society. If the club were prosecuted the Dolice were agreeable to the withdrawal of the individual charges, whereon the Magistrate (Mr Hunt) fined the club £l, and dismissed the charges against the officials.
